Meaning 1
The unsaturated chlorinated hydrocarbon CCl2=CHCl used as an industrial solvent and formerly as an anaesthetic.
Definition source: English Wiktionary via Wiktextract
The nurse gave the woman in labour trichloroethylene, a chemical also used to clean metal parts.

Meaning 2
a heavy colorless highly toxic liquid used as a solvent to clean electronic components and for dry cleaning and as a fumigant; causes cancer and liver and lung damage
